Your Responsibilities
As a Quality Engineer - Weld for John Deere Dubuque Works you will ensure high quality build, continuous process improvement and collaborate to provide world class customer services.
Located in Dubuque, Iowa (Ranked in top 100 best places to live in the U.S. in a report done by Livability), this John Deere business unit creates the environment for perfecting process design review, fabrication quality investigation and order fulfillment process production support.
Specifically, your responsibilities include:
- Leading business unit quality goals focused on build in quality and continuous improvement.
- Executing quality management activities such as fabrication quality improvement team, process design reviews, and failure modes and effects analysis (FMEA).
- Leading quality activities including order fulfillment process (OFP) production support, control plan execution and assistance to customer support.
- Providing work direction to quality special investigators in fabrication.

What Skills You Need
- Experience implementing improvements in design, quality, efficiency, and/or productivity.
- Experience using corrective action tools such as root cause analysis (RCA) and mistake proofing techniques.
- 1 or more years of experience using engineering tools and processes.
- Experience gathering, analyzing, and summarizing complex data to make sound decisions.
- Experience working effectively in a team environment.
- Effective communication with ability to engage others.
- Proven ability to successfully learn and adopt new technologies, systems, processes, and tools.
What Makes You Stand Out
- Experience working with KOTEM smart profile GD&T Evaluation Software.
- General proficiency using computer-aided design tools such as AutoCAD.
- 2 or more years’ experience supporting engineering projects in a factory, warehouse, and/or industrial environment.
- Experience reading and interpreting engineering drawings and utilizing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ing (GD&T).
- 2 or more years’ experience with advanced Excel functions
- Excellent communicator with experience in supporting factory and/or supplier relationships to solve business problems.
- Experience in welding processes and industrial robotics.
Education
Ideally you will have a degree or equivalent related work experience in the following:
- Bachelor’s degree in Engineering, Analytics, Industrial Technology, or a similar technical discipline.
